Size and growth of the industry

The tech industry in Australia has emerged as a significant contributor to the country’s economy. The sector has experienced continuous growth over the years, contributing significantly to employment and innovation.

According to the Australian Computer Society (ACS), the tech industry employs over 861,000 professionals, accounting for approximately 7% of the total workforce in Australia.

This highlights the sector’s size and its essential role in the country’s job market.

Furthermore, the industry’s growth rate has been exceptional. The Digital Pulse 2020 report by Deloitte Access Economics found that the tech industry has been growing at a faster rate than the overall Australian economy.

It projected a 2.3% annual growth in tech employment by 2024, outpacing the growth rate of the national workforce.

Statistics and data supporting the discussion

According to a study conducted by LinkedIn, Australia witnessed a 22% year-on-year growth in tech employment in 2020. The country experienced one of the highest growth rates in the Asia-Pacific region.

In terms of salaries, the average annual wage for tech professionals in Australia is around AUD 100,000, surpassing the national average across all industries.

Additionally, Australian cities have been recognized globally for their tech talent. For instance, Sydney ranks 16th in the Global Startup Ecosystem Report 2020, highlighting its vibrant tech job market and start-up ecosystem.

Discuss its size, growth, and significance in the current world economy

The size of the global tech job market is massive, with numerous opportunities available for professionals in various tech-related fields.

According to Statista, the worldwide IT services market is projected to reach $1.1 trillion in 2021, showcasing the market’s substantial size and potential.

In terms of growth, the tech job market has seen consistent expansion over the years.

Technological advancements, digital transformation, and the rise of emerging technologies like artificial intelligence and blockchain have fueled the demand for tech talent.

As companies across industries embrace digitalization, the need for skilled tech professionals has become even more crucial.

The global tech job market’s significance in the current world economy cannot be overstated. Tech companies contribute significantly to GDP growth and job creation.

According to a study by Oxford Economics, the technology sector accounts for 7.7% of the global economy and employs over 120 million workers worldwide.

Comparison of salaries and benefits

Comparison of Salaries and Benefits in AU and Global Tech Job Markets

When it comes to comparing the AU and global tech job markets, one of the critical aspects to consider is the salaries and benefits offered in these markets. Let’s delve into the details and analyze the differences.

Average Salaries and Benefits

In the AU tech job market, the average salaries and benefits are influenced by factors like the cost of living, skills in demand, and industry standards. On a global scale, the tech job market has its own unique dynamics.

In AU, the average salary for tech professionals ranges from $80,000 to $120,000 per year, depending on the specific role and experience level.

Moreover, companies offer additional benefits such as health insurance, retirement plans, and flexible work arrangements.

On the global front, tech salaries can vary significantly based on the region. In countries like the United States, average salaries for tech roles can be as high as $100,000 to $150,000 per year.

Cost of Living

The cost of living plays a crucial role in determining the salaries and benefits offered in both the AU and global tech job markets. In AU, the cost of living is relatively high compared to some other regions.

As a result, employers in AU tend to offer higher salaries to compensate for the higher cost of living. On the other hand, in some global tech job markets with a lower cost of living, employers may offer relatively lower salaries.

It is essential to consider the cost of living when comparing the salaries and benefits between the AU and global tech job markets.
